Mineral deposits
« on: April 25, 2009, 10:50:08 am »
How long do you reckon it takes for them to form?
Say you hose the windows with a garden hose, do you think the damage is done the minute they dry or hours or weeks later?

What i'm getting at is this: I plan to clean outsides of gutters and soffits with a pressure washer. I live in a hard water area prone to high limescale deposits. I don't want to splatter the glass only to have it dry and stain before i've had a chance to wfp it.

I am currently pressure washing the roof on a store at Cobham, the van was directly underneath where I needed to work, alongside a cherry picker.

I started to wash the area down on Thursday - after finishing and the van was covered in algae, moss, crap etc - pressure washed the van and trailer off and then rinsed off the surrounding area.

Hey presto - Friday morning limescale deposits all over the windscreen!!!

They were probably there Thursday afternoon, as soon as it dried.
